The use of mortars of lower cement content is unsatisfactory since any notable reduction in cement contents leads to reduced workability and less cohesion and will produce porous joints with a tendency for low frost resistance. Mortar serves many important functions: it bonds units together into an integral structural assembly, seals joints against penetration by air and moisture, accommodates small movements within a wall, accommodates slight differences between unit sizes, and bonds to joint reinforcement, ties and anchors so that all elements perform as an assembly. Since chlorides accelerate the corrosion of steel reinforcement and accessories ASTM C1384 stipulates that admixtures add not more than 65 ppm (0.0065%) water-soluble chloride or 90 ppm (0.0090%) acid-soluble chloride by weight of portland cement.
